These drawings depict intimate narratives with frames carefully crafted by the artist himself, like a puzzle to be assembled. He constantly plays with the contrast between background and form, transforming anecdotes while exploring a multitude of small stories. The reoccurring animal motifs, such as bats, carp, or whales, in this way contribute to his leading narratives. Enduring power dynamics and numerous expectations that humans place on animals find ideal allegorical representation in Bosmans’s works.
